Objects looks exactly the same when viewed through a transparent object. A transparent body allows light to pass through completely. Therefore, the image formed will completely resemble that of the object to be viewed.
Examples are air, glass, pure water.
A translucent body partially allows light to pass through it. Most times, the image is not clear and it is distorted.
An opaque object will not allow light pass through it. It completely obstructs the ray of path of light. An opaque body will produce an image on the screen.

Motor neurons are a type of nervous system cells that are located in the brain and in the spinal cord. They have the function of producing the stimuli that cause the contraction of the different muscle groups of the organism. They are therefore essential for daily activities that require muscle contraction: walking, talking, moving hands and in general all body movements.

The acceleration that causes an object to move along a circular path, or turn is known as the centripetal acceleration. Centripetal acceleration points radially inward from the object's position and making a right angle with the object's velocity vector.
The centripetal acceleration is given as
Ac = v^2 / r
where Ac represents the centripetal acceleration of an object.
v represents the linear velocity
r represents the radius of rotation.
Given t = 0.64 s, r = 1.8 m.
To find linear velocity, v = (2 * pi * r) / t
= (2 * 3.14 * 1.8) / 0.64
v = 17.6 m / s.
Centripetal acceleration = v^2 / r
= (17.6 * 17.6) / 1.8
= 172 m / s^2.
